§ 45-37-60 — Definitions

As herein used, these terms have the meanings hereby given them:
(1)CORONER-MEDICAL EXAMINERS’ OFFICE. The office wherein or wherefrom the staff performs the duties the governing body assigns the staff.
(2)GOVERNING BODY. The governing body of Jefferson County.
(3)STAFF. The coroner-medical examiners, representatives, and agents this part authorizes the governing body to appoint.

Legislative History
(Act 79-454, p. 739, §1.)
